Woman Bathing, Taisho era, October 1915 (colour woodblock print)

FSG348855 Woman Bathing, Taisho era, October 1915 (colour woodblock print) by Hashiguchi, Goyo (c.1880-1921); 40.7 x 26.6 cm; Arthur M. Sackler Gallery, Smithsonian Institution, USA; Arthur M. Sackler Gallery, Smithsonian Institution; Gift of H. Ed Robison in memory of Ulrike Pietzner-Robison; Japanese, out of copyright

This print titled "Woman Bathing, Taisho era, October 1915" takes us back to a bygone era in Japan. Created by the talented artist Hashiguchi Goyo during the early 20th century, this colour woodblock print beautifully captures the essence of femininity and grace. The image depicts a woman bathing in serene solitude, surrounded by nature's tranquility. The delicate brushstrokes and vibrant colors bring life to every detail, from the flowing water cascading down her body to the gentle ripples on its surface. The artist's attention to minute details showcases his mastery of technique and composition. As we gaze upon this artwork, we are transported to a time when traditional Japanese customs were still prevalent. The Taisho era was known for its cultural renaissance and liberal attitudes towards art and fashion.
